How Will They Fit Different Faces?

Gentle Monster’s acetate nose beds and structure tend to suit low to mid-level bridges with rounder cheeks, reducing slip and pinch. Dimensions is predictable: check the lens-bridge-temple numbers and match them accurately to a frame that already fits you.

Use your best-fitting frame’s marked size (for example, 51–20–147) and target within 1–2 mm for eye size plus bridge, and zero to five mm for side length. Those needing bridge accommodation generally do better at bridge measurements of 18–20 with thicker nose beds; taller bridges might push to 21–23 if movement is an issue. If temples clamp behind the ears or leave marks, step up several mm in temple measurement or ask a store to add a gentle outward bend. Round or heart faces pair well with rectangles like Her or Lang, while square faces work better with the softened corners of Lilit. If your nasal bridge stays extremely narrow, consider metallic plus combination models with flexible pad arms from the prescription series with micro-adjustments.

How Can You Verify Authenticity Eliminating Guesswork?

Purchase from official boutiques or authorized retailers, then cross-check the style identifier, color code, and measurements on the temple against the package marking plus product page. Examine finishing: properly placed logos, crisp lettering, smooth hinge operation, and aligned lenses are baseline for the real thing.

Packaging should include a branded case, cleaning cloth, and papers; wrong fonts, off-center marking, and misspelled model names are immediate red flags. Cross-reference product photos on the official site to every detail on the actual frames, including logo location and temple internal patterning. If you bought online from a third party, use high-resolution photos and natural illumination to inspect polish quality and edge transitions—fakes cut corners here. When in doubt, contact customer service with the model identifier and retailer information for validation.

Pro advice: “If you need to buy on a marketplace, request a photo of the arm imprint, box tag, and a scale reading of the frame’s weight; fakes often miss the precise size code and change markedly in weight even when they look similar.”

Care, Warranty, and After-Sales Reality

Gentle Monster supports manufacturing defects with a restricted warranty and includes in-store adjustments that meaningfully improve comfort. Regular care extends longevity more than any item you can buy.

Clean lenses with tepid water before drying to avoid surface damage, and use a clean microfiber—avoid paper towels. Check screws gently every couple months or have a shop do it; over-torquing can crack frame material around hinges. Temperature adjustments are best left to professionals to avoid warping. Coverage omits wear-and-tear like scratches, so treat optics carefully and place frames in the case. If you require replacement parts, going through official channels preserves fit and finish consistency.
